Transaction 6339af624fdc1980b5ec7fd62895828b670f8f0fe209d760cd40a22d4d2612ac
1 Input
1 Output
-
6339af624fdc1980b5ec7fd62895828b670f8f0fe209d760cd40a22d4d2612ac:0
- value
- 155644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ae40a91fa8a8ab3acc474b615f252aadf128af7 OP_EQUAL
- address
- 3BSCjTtRYBw9QnJVUL3bmz18iF5eCUKR7m